Previously we processed each carrier event inline, which caused timeouts whenever the upstream sent burst traffic after an outage. Events are now enqueued and acknowledged immediately, with a worker pool draining the queue and deduplicating by event sequence number. Retries use exponential backoff with jitter, and stale events older than the cutoff are dropped with a metric. Maintainers should rarely need to touch this; if throughput changes, adjust the tuning constants defined below.

tuning table, yajog-yahof:
BUDGETS = {
    "lamvan": 303,
    "wenox": 460,
    "fenvan": 525,
}

## Service accounts: FD leak hunt

The `fdwatch` service account exists solely for the Bramblegate descriptor-leak investigation. It can read process metrics on prod hosts, nothing else. Run the sweep script hourly; flag any process exceeding 4,000 open descriptors. Do not reuse this account for other tooling. The account authenticates to the metrics collector with the key below.

service key, yajef-kajef: kto11_OoNe9JNSuFD

Runbook: account recovery during the Userline module extraction from the Harrowgate monolith. If a reviewer's access breaks mid-migration, verify their record exists in both the legacy table and the new Userline store before proceeding. Do not recreate accounts manually. Instead, restore the migration session using the recovery passphrase recorded immediately below.

unlock words, yagag-yahog: gordor-zorvan-druius-queniel-normir-norwyn-framir-novmir-ralius-holwyn-wenwyn-tamael-silok-holdor

Hi Soren,

Welcome aboard the Marrowgate on-call rotation. One thing that bites new folks: rate limiting in the Tollway gateway. Internal services get per-team quotas, and when a team exceeds theirs you'll see 429 spikes that look like an outage but aren't. Before paging anyone, check the quota dashboard and confirm which team is over budget. Adjusting limits requires a config PR, not a console change. The full quota policy and adjustment workflow are on the internal page below.

runbook for yajog-tahag: https://jira.norvasys.corp/spaces/job/display/ca5ff3fa4d4d